Tax Breaks and Deductions

There are also many tax benefits to owning a home. Homeowners can deduct the interest they pay on their mortgages, as well as the property taxes they pay each year. These deductions can add up to significant savings at tax time. In addition, homeowners who sell their homes for a profit may be able to exclude up to $500,000 of that profit from capital gains taxes. This can be a massive saving for homeowners who have owned their homes for many years.

Equity That Can Be Used for Future Investments

As the real estate market continues to grow, so does the equity in your home. This equity can be used for future investments, such as sending a child to college or starting a business. It seems more people are taking advantage of this opportunity every day.

According to a study done by the Joint Center for Housing Studies at Harvard University, nearly 40 percent of U.S. homeowners tapped into their home equity in 2016 to finance other purchases or needs. This is the highest level since 2007 and shows that more people view their homes as valuable assets again.
